Warning Signs You Need Ceiling Water Damage Repair
Ignoring ceiling water damage can lead to bigger problems. You might not notice it at first, but the signs are there. Catching it early can save you money and prevent more serious issues down the line. That’s why it’s important to pay attention to what your home is telling you.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A damp, moldy smell in your home is a sign of hidden moisture. You might not see the water, but it’s there. This can lead to mold growth and health problems. Hidden moisture is dangerous. Unpleasant odors are a warning. Early detection prevents bigger issues.
Discolored or Sagging Ceilings
If your ceiling looks wet, smells damp, or feels soft, that’s a red flag. Water can weaken the structure and cause collapse. You need to act fast before the damage gets worse. Visible damage means trouble. Soft spots are dangerous. Quick action prevents disaster.
Water Stains or Damp Patches
Stains on your ceiling or walls are a sign of past or ongoing water damage. Even small leaks can lead to big problems if not fixed. You might not see the source, but the damage is there. Visible stains are a warning. Hidden leaks can cause serious damage. Timely repair stops the spread.
Peeling Paint or Bubbling Wallpaper
Paint that’s peeling or wallpaper that’s bubbling is a sign of moisture underneath. This can happen after a leak or a flood. You need to check the area for water damage. Surface changes show hidden issues. Moisture buildup is dangerous. Proper inspection finds the problem.
Unusual Sounds From the Ceiling
If you hear dripping, gurgling, or other strange noises from your ceiling, that’s a sign of water. You might not see it, but it’s there. This can mean a leak or a pipe issue. Suspicious noises are a red flag. Hidden water is dangerous. Expert help finds the source.
Higher Than Normal Humidity Levels
If your home feels more humid than usual, especially in one area, that’s a sign of moisture. This can lead to mold and other issues. You might not notice it at first, but the damage is growing. High humidity is a risk. Moisture buildup is a problem. Early intervention prevents long-term damage.

Ceiling Water Damage Repair Cost In Charlottesville, VA
Costs for ceiling water damage repair vary based on the severity of the damage. You might expect to pay anywhere from $500 to $2,500 depending on the size of the area and the type of repairs needed. These are general estimates and can change based on your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$200 – $800 | Amount of water and accessibility of the area. |
| Structural drying | $500 – $1,500 | Size of the area and how long drying takes. |
| Repair of drywall | $300 – $1,200 | Extent of the damage and materials used. |
| Insulation replacement | $200 – $600 | Type of insulation and area size. |
| Mold remediation |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of the mold and affected area. |
| Final inspection and cleanup | $100 – $300 | Amount of work and time required. |
